If you are constantly getting the NetReg page with a router, try these steps in order:
- Clear your IE Cache
- Open Internet Explorer
- Click Tools
- Click Internet Options
- Click on the Delete Files Button
- A window will pop up. If you see a Delete all offline content check-box, select it.
- Click OK
- Click OK again.
- Close your browser and then open it again. Attempt to Netreg once more.

- If this does not work, follow the instructions to remove Spyware and Adware.
- Release/Renew your IP Address
- First, click start, and then select run...

- In the Run Dialog, type cmd and then click OK

- In the command prompt, type ipconfig /release . This will release your IP address back to the system.

- Next, type ipconfig /renew . This will query the network for a new IP address.

- Reboot Your Computer
